Description
This mod replaces the Swine Chopper, Swine Wretch, Swine Slasher, Swine Drummer and Carrion Eater enemies with waifufied versions.

It has four different versions. To use the different versions, you will need to replace the images yourself. They can be found within the folder labeled "alternate versions" within this mods directory, which is "3453515615" in the Workshop folder. Simply pick the version you want to use and replace the monsters folder in the mod directory.
